  • Tornado touches down near DIA

    A confirmed tornado touched down near Denver International Airport Tuesday afternoon, sending travelers scrambling to get into tornado shelters and stunned passengers on airplanes and in vehicles taking pictures of the astounding sight. The tornado, spotted on the eastern side of the airport, was described as moving northeast at 5 miles per hour before it lifted, weakened and then dissipated, ...

  • Recall effort against Morse deemed sufficient

    DENVER (AP) - A recall petition against Colorado Senate President John Morse has been deemed sufficient, setting up the first potential recall of a state lawmaker in Colorado history.The Democrat from Colorado Springs was targeted for his support of gun control measures signed into law this spring. The gun rights supporters were especially unhappy with a new law to expand required background ...

  • Firefighters Battle Worst Fire in Colorado History

    Giant flames and thick smoke are moving across Colorado Thursday. Three massive wildfires continue to burn out of control and hot temperatures, gusty winds and dry forests are only fueling the flames. The Black Forest Fire near Colorado Springs is growing. Raging flames have wiped out at least 360 homes, making it the most destructive fire in state history. So far, more than 9,000 people have ...
